Télécharger kaftan.eso

Retour à la liste

Numérotation des lignes :

kaftan
  1. C KAFTAN SOURCE CB215821 17/11/30 21:16:33 9639
  2. SUBROUTINE KAFTAN(R1,Z1,RA,ZA,RB,ZB,A)
  3. IMPLICIT INTEGER(I-N)
  4. IMPLICIT REAL*8 (A-H,O-Z)
  5. C----------------------------------------------------------------------
  6. C SP appele par KAINTE
  7. C existence d un point tangent associe au segment obstructeur AB
  8. C points (RA,ZA) et (RB,ZB)
  9. C resultat A : 2 si exterieur
  10. C : represente un cosinus sinon
  11. C----------------------------------------------------------------------
  12.  
  13. DMIN=1.D-3
  14. IF(ABS(ZB-ZA).LE.DMIN) THEN
  15. A=2.
  16. ELSE
  17. A=Z1*(RB-RA)+(RA*ZB-RB*ZA)
  18. A=A/R1/(ZB-ZA)
  19. ENDIF
  20. RETURN
  21. END
  22.  
  23.  
  24.  
  25.  
  26.  

© Cast3M 2003 - Tous droits réservés.
Mentions légales